Mrs. Gregoria Tio Canieso, 86, of Ladson, died Friday, July 11, 2008. She was the widow of Alejo C. Canieso, 2nd Lt., United States Army, WWII.
The Mass of Christian Burial will be held twelve oclock, Monday, July 14, 2008 in Immaculate Conception Catholic Church in Goose Creek. Final Commendation and Farewell will follow at Smoak Cemetery in Ruffin. The family will receive friends Monday from 11 until the hour of service at the church.
Mrs. Canieso was born February 13, 1922 in Nagbalaye Sta. Catalina, Negros Oriental, Philippines and was a daughter of Emelio Tio and Antonia Deloria Adepon Tio. She was a retired school teacher and was a member of Immaculate Conception Catholic Church.
Surviving are: her daughters, Milagros Faiardo of the Philippines, Bernadette Bunton of Ladson, Jessie Maio of New Jersey, Teresita Canieso of Goose Creek, Charito Kilat of the Philippines, Evangeline Esposito Beeman of California, Susan Clemente of Orlando, Florida and Jacqueline Pacion of the Philippines; her son, Lt. Commander Gilbert Canieso, United States Navy, stationed in Iraq; 16 grandchildren; and 6 great grandchildren.
